Abstract

A steel-scintillator sandwich counter was used as a simple and highly efficient detector for both neutrons and protons. The validity of simple approximations for the detection efficiency was investigated by experimental tests and a detailed Monte Carlo calculation of the nuclear and electromagnetic cascades in the counter.
